Therapeutic hypothermia

Area of Science:

  • Neuroscience and critical care medicine.

Context:

  • Severe head injury management remains challenging, with therapeutic hypothermia use being debated.
  • Hyperthermia is a known negative prognostic factor in traumatic brain and ischemic injuries.
  • Intracranial pressure (ICP) correlates with core body temperature, suggesting hypothermia's potential role.

Purpose:

  • To explore the controversial benefits and underlying reasons for using therapeutic hypothermia in severe head injury.
  • To review evidence supporting hypothermia's efficacy in related conditions like cerebral ischemia and cardiac arrest.
  • To identify unresolved questions impacting clinical study discrepancies.

Summary:

  • Hypothermia's efficacy is shown in animal models of cerebral ischemia and human cardiac arrest studies.
  • Core body temperature influences ICP, and hypothermia may reduce intracranial hypertension.
